In Depth: China’s Tech Giants Burn Cash to Try to Dominate AI Health Care

By Cui Xiaotian, Chen Xi and Lu Zhenhua
2026年02月05日 17:58
Companies like Ant Group and ByteDance are pouring hundreds of millions of yuan into personalized medical consultations, but a profitable business model remains elusive

In China, the battle for consumer users of medical artificial intelligence (AI) has begun. In late 2025, Ant Group Co. Ltd. unleashed a blitz of advertising for its rebranded personal health assistant, called Afu, burning through hundreds of millions of yuan in a single month. By early 2026, on the other side of the ocean, OpenAI released its personal health assistant, ChatGPT Health, opening beta testing to a small group of users.
